Pay attention to this site. We are putting the finishing touches on the faculty, curriculum, and dates and times for the Summer 2019 Jazz Day Camp. Returning as falculty are Victor Jones, Alex Blake, Alex Foster, Charles Blenzig and Richard Boulger. We are adding the superlative guitarist/composer David Gilmore who in addition to his touring is an instructor affiliated with the Berklee College of Music.

The Camp is scheduled for August 19th through the 23rd. Classes will be from 1 to 4 p.m.. The Camp will, once again, be hosted at Hoosac Valley Regional High School under the direction of Jacob Keplinger.

The Camp will be open to qualified high school and middle school students from Berkshire County, all at no charge. Note, however, the number of slots available is limited. Watch this space for more information concerning the process and procedure for enrollment consideration.

RICHARD BOULGER
North Adams native and 1984 graduate of Drury High School,

Richard Boulger received the legacy of trumpet playing and teaching first from his father, Richard Boulger, Sr. Boulger has since spent a lifetime studying the art forms of playing the trumpet and flugelhorn with a ‘who’s-who’ list of jazz greats, as well as music composition, and improvisation.

After completing his BFA from The Hartt School of Music and Master’s degree from Rutgers University, Boulger became a longtime private student of both Freddie Hubbard and Donald Byrd, and studied music composition extensively with Ludmila Uhlela (former chair of Contemporary Music, Manhattan School of Music). Boulger produced numerous albums as a leader and recorded with several diverse Grammy- and award-winning artists such as The Allman Brothers’ Band, Little Louie Vega, “Joe,” Randy Brecker, Joshua Thompson, and John Hicks. Freddie Hubbard declared, “I am very happy and honored to be a witness to a great trumpet player.”

As an educator, Richard has worked closely with over 30 NYC public schools as well as given numerous band clinics at colleges, high schools, middle schools, and private schools. His educational writings have been published in Downbeat Magazine, Hal Leonard Music, The New York Brass Conference, and many more. He also teaches numerous private students in New York City as well as internationally, via SKYPE. Most recently, Boulger created and published “Long-Tone Meditations” and is a co-creator of RS Berkeley’s new JORB, a brass-embouchure training tool.

Alex Foster, tenor, alto saxophonist and multi-woodwind artist, is a mu-sical heavyweight famous for his over quarter-century of performances with the House Band of “Saturday Night Live,” is also a musical director of the Mingus Big Band. From Oakland, California, Alex Foster has been part of many of the world’s most influential sounds. Foster has shared the stage with world-class performers including Jaco Pastorius, Herbie Han-cock, McCoy Tyner, Miles Davis, Duke Ellington, Freddie Hubbard, Nat and Cannonball Adderley, Rahsaan Roland Kirk, Gil Evans, John Scofield, Charles Mingus, Elvin Jones, Thad Jones, Tito Puente, Michael Brecker, Dizzy Gillespie, Aretha Franklin, Aerosmith, Stevie Wonder, Dr. John, Paul Simon, Elton John, Paul McCartney, Eddie Van Halen, The Village People, Sister Sledge,
Al Green, Johnny Mathis, Diana Ross, and many others.

Foster has had his work with the Mingus Big Band, Mingus Dynasty, and the Mingus Big Band nominated for a Grammy Award in 2005. A wood-winds instructor, Foster is also a master player of the clarinet and flute and teaches in master-class workshops up and down the east coast to students from middle school through college.

Alex Blake is a post-bop double-bassist and electric bass guitarist. Blake was born Alejandro Blake Fearon, Jr., in Panama, and moved to the U.S. at the age of 7, where he grew up in Brooklyn, NY. He began his career with Sun Ra in his band Arkestra. He became one of the major proponents of the fusion movement in the late 1970s with his writing and performances with Lenny White and Billy Cobham.

A live performance compilation was released by Bubble Core Records in 2000 entitled, Now is the Time: Live at the Knitting Factory. The album features Blake’s own quintet which included Pharaoh Sanders, Victor Jones, John Hicks, and Neil Clarke (percussion). In addition to leading his own group, Blake also plays and records with Randy Weston, and many other musicians.

“Victor Jones is a new breed of outstanding drummer bandleaders....nothing Jones does is ever boring.”
New York Time Out Magazine

For the past several years, Jones has been recording and performing with his own group, Culture-Versy, effortlessly blending Hip Hop, Urban Soul, Modern Jazz, and Funk. Victor Jones is a leader who understands and plays with every facet of great American music and popular art forms.

Internationally recognized for his consistent, subtle, and stylist drumming on stage and in the studio, Victor Jones is known as an innovator who is not afraid to bring together different styles and sounds. He has played on hundreds of recordings, played hundreds of live concerts and performed in clubs everywhere on this planet, often as a backing musician for a variety of well-known artists, including Lou Donaldson, Chaka Khan, Woody Shaw, Freddie Hubbard, Stan Getz, and many others.

Charles Blenzig is an American jazz pianist, composer, arranger, producer, and educator. In the mid-80s Blenzig joined the legendary Gil Evans’ Monday Night Orchestra that performed weekly at Sweet Basil Jazz Club. Blenzig has performed with Michael Brecker, Marcus Miller, Bill Evans (saxophonist with Miles Davis), Hiram Bullock, Lew Soloff, Kenwood Dennard, Eddie Gomez, Dave Weckle, Joe Locke, Harvey Mason, Joe Beck, and Italian rapper Jovanotti, among others. Blenzig has been musical director for singer/songwriter Michael Franks since 1990, and for the late Latin jazz saxophonist Gato Barbieri. Blenzig has toured extensively throughout the world as a leader and sideman including South Africa, Indonesia, Thailand, Japan, Republic of Georgia, Europe and Korea.

Professor Blenzig is a member of the SUNY Purchase Conservatory Jazz Department faculty along with Jon Faddis, Hal Galper, John Abercrombie and Todd Coolman.

Youth Jazz Camp 2019

An esteemed group of master jazz musicians and clinicians — a faculty made up of recording artists, performers, composers, inventors, and authors — will come together for a high school jazz day camp designed especially for eager, committed young players. Under the musical direction of Richard Boulger, for the second year the camp will be hosted by band director Jacob Keplinger, at Hoosac Valley High School, Cheshire, Ma. The camp will be held from August 19-23, 2019. Daily Sessions are from 1-5pm.

Participants may be recommended to attend by their respective school band directors. Schools invited to participate for this summer 2019 camp are: Mount Greylock Regional High School, Hoosac Valley High School, Wahconah High School, Pittsfield High School, Taconic High School, Monument Mountain High School, Lenox Memorial High School, Lee Middle and High School, McCann Technical Vocational High School, Drury Senior High School, and BART.

Exceptional cases will be considered for notable middle-school student talent.
